diff options
author | Rob Austein <sra@hactrn.net> | 2016-01-20 23:15:38 +0000 |
---|---|---|
committer | Rob Austein <sra@hactrn.net> | 2016-01-20 23:15:38 +0000 |
commit | aa77e34c8cc1f675dd8f86f713c3ce8a06fece8a (patch) | |
tree | aa64fa1f813554366083c0271027fbead7de31a8 /rpki/pubd.py | |
parent | 3cd14c0dfd61be32ce56fb065cd6c89c60e874f9 (diff) |
Process deltas incrementally (one SQL commit per delta) and mutate
existing RRDPSnapshot objects while applying deltas rather than
creating new ones. This simplifies cleanup, avoids locking out the
I/O loop for the duration of a long commit, and allows us to salvage
whatever progress we were able to make if a network problem stops us
partway through fetching a long series of deltas.
svn path=/branches/tk705/; revision=6229
Diffstat (limited to 'rpki/pubd.py')
0 files changed, 0 insertions, 0 deletions